      Google has already released Android 17, and Vivo is now preparing to roll out its next major software update with OriginOS 7. The company has also opened the Android 17 Beta Program for developers on its flagship Vivo X300 Pro, indicating that the stable rollout could begin later this year.

      Vivo OriginOS 7 Overview

      OriginOS 7: What to expect?

      Vivo hasn't shared the complete list of OriginOS 7 features yet, but the update is expected to build on the improvements introduced with OriginOS 6 rather than bringing a complete redesign. Instead, the focus will likely be on refining the overall software experience with smoother animations, better performance, improved battery efficiency, and smarter AI-powered features.

      Here are some of the features that are expected to arrive with Android 17-based OriginOS 7:

      FeatureWhat to Expect
      Smarter AI AssistantA more capable AI assistant that can understand your requests better and perform actions across multiple apps with natural voice interactions.
      Natural Language SearchSearch for photos, files, chats, or even system settings using everyday language instead of exact keywords.
      Improved Battery ManagementAI-powered battery optimization that learns your usage habits to reduce background power consumption and improve standby battery life.
      Enhanced Lock ScreenNew customization options with animated effects, smart widgets, and a more personalized lock screen experience.
      Better MultitaskingImproved split-screen mode, smoother floating windows, and faster app switching for better productivity.
      AI Writing ToolsBuilt-in AI tools for writing, grammar correction, translation, and text summarization across supported apps.
      Enhanced Privacy & SecurityBetter permission management and improved control over background app activity.
      Cross-Device ConnectivityEasier file sharing, synced notifications, and a more seamless experience across Vivo phones, tablets, and wearables.
      Smoother System PerformanceRefined animations, quicker app launches, and an overall smoother, more responsive interface.
      AI Photo EditingNew AI-powered editing tools, including object removal, background editing, and other intelligent photo enhancements.
      Note: Since Vivo hasn't officially announced OriginOS 7 yet, the features listed above are based on leaks and the company's previous software roadmap.

      Expected rollout timeline

      Although Vivo hasn't confirmed an official release schedule, the company typically follows Google's Android release cycle fairly closely. Based on previous rollouts, here's what the Android 17-based OriginOS 7 timeline could look like:

      TimelineExpected Activity
      July – August 2026Internal testing and closed beta development
      September 2026Early previews and developer beta
      October – November 2026Official OriginOS 7 announcement
      November – December 2026Stable rollout begins for flagship devices
      Early 2027Update expands to eligible mid-range and older supported devices

      Vivo Android 17 (OriginOS 7) eligible devices

      Android 17
      Vivo SeriesEligible Devices
      Vivo X SeriesVivo X Fold6, Vivo X300 Ultra, Vivo X300 Pro, Vivo X300, Vivo X300s, Vivo X600, Vivo X Fold5, Vivo X200 Ultra, Vivo X F10 Pro, Vivo X200 Pro mini, Vivo X200s, Vivo X200, Vivo X Fold3 Pro, Vivo X Fold3, Vivo X100 Pro, Vivo X100, Vivo X100s, Vivo X Fold2
      Vivo S SeriesVivo S60 Pro mini, Vivo S60, Vivo X Fold2, Vivo S60 Pro mini, Vivo S60, Vivo X Flip, Vivo S50 Pro mini, Vivo S30, Vivo S20 Pro, Vivo S30, Vivo S20 Pro, Vivo S20, Vivo S19 Pro, Vivo S19
      Vivo Pad SeriesVivo Pad6 Pro, Vivo Pad6, Vivo Pad5 Pro, Vivo Pad5, Vivo Pad5e
      Vivo V SeriesVivo V70, Vivo V70 FE, Vivo V70 Elite, Vivo V60, Vivo V60e, Vivo V60 Lite, Vivo V60 Lite 4G, Vivo V50, Vivo V50e, Vivo V50 Lite, Vivo V50 Lite 4G, Vivo V40, Vivo V40 Pro
      Vivo T SeriesVivo T4, Vivo T4 Pro, Vivo T4 Ultra, Vivo T4 Lite, Vivo T4x, Vivo T4R
      Vivo Y SeriesVivo Y600, Vivo Y500GT, Vivo Y500 Pro+, Vivo Y500 Pro, Vivo Y500, Vivo Y500i, Vivo Y400 4G, Vivo Y400 Pro, Vivo Y400 Pro+, Vivo Y300 GT, Vivo Y500t, Vivo Y300i, Vivo Y31d 4G, Vivo Y21 (2026), Vivo Y11 (2026), Vivo Y05 4G

      Vivo has not officially confirmed the complete Android 17 eligibility list. The devices above are based on the company's current software update policy and previous rollout history.
